1928 $10,000 Federal Reserve Note. There are only eight 1928 series $10,000 Federal Reserve notes known to exist today, and two of them are in museums. The 1928 $10,000 notes issued from the Federal Reserve Bank of Cleveland are worth around $115,000 in very fine condition. In extremely fine condition the value is around $225,000.

The $10,000 bill is the highest denomination of U.S. currency that was ever printed for circulation. It was originally issued in the late 1800s and was used primarily by banks to transfer large sums of money between each other.
